Actually taken at Strathbeg lagoon near to the RSPB Reserve. Was in the company of 46 Barnacle geese one of which was wearing a GPS neck collar. Later found out that the tagged bird was ringed as a female gosling in 2005 and winters in the Solway Firth. Later on 22/05 the birds flew across the North Sea to land in Norway by evening. No doubt en route to Svalbard but the Richardson's needs to make a left turn somewhere along the way if it wants to get back home! Thanks to WWT and Kane Brides for the ringing info.
